The Way to Best LCOE (V)
Following the calculation of 210mm modules with fixed tilts in Fraunhofer ISE study I, Fraunhofer ISE, the world leading solar energy research institute, has also evaluated and studied the LCOE of ground power plants, with the combination of the new generation of ultra-high power Module and 1P tracker. The combination of single-axis 1P tracking system and bifacial modules delivers more power generation, thereby significantly reducing the LCOE and improving the return on investment.

The Way to Best LCOE (IV)
Since the launch of the 600W+ series, world leading design institutes and well-known third-party organizations have evaluated and studied the LCOE advantage and value of Vertex modules. Recently, Fraunhofer ISE, the world leading solar institution, has completed the assessment of CAPEX and LCOE of new generation of ultra-high power modules 210mm (G12) from Trina Solar and 182mm (M10) series from other manufacturer.
